On average across the year,
Vanuatu is approximately as hot as
Kendale Lakes, Florida
.
Vanuatu has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Kendale Lakes, Florida has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F.
Vanuatu's hottest month is February,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is not hotter than Kendale Lakes, Florida's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F).
On average across the year, Vanuatu is approximately as cold as Kendale Lakes, Florida . Vanuatu has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F and Kendale Lakes, Florida has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F.
On average across the year,
no, Vanuatu has less rain than
Kendale Lakes, Florida. Vanuatu has an average annual rainfall of 1368mm and Kendale Lakes, Florida has an average annual rainfall of 1963mm.
Vanuatu's wettest month is March, with an average monthly rainfall of 160mm, which is drier than Kendale Lakes, Florida's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 302mm).
